Top St Mary’s Church Hotel Reviews
The Painswick Retreat
10/10 Excellent
"We spent an incredible 3-day weekend at the Retreat in Painswick. Sue and Tim are extremely accommodating and will make the trip perfect, from having thought through all the details of the house, to having everything like at home, to sharing recommendations and being extremely responsive before and during your time there. This definitely was a highlight The photographs and videos on the website are beautiful, but they still don’t quite prepare you for how peaceful and serene the Retreat feels in person. There is a real sense of calm about the building and their surroundings that is difficult to capture on camera, and despite being a large group we found there was plenty of space to spend time together as well as quieter areas to retreat to. The owners do operate a very clear and quite strict noise policy, particularly later in the evening and around the outside areas. Having spent time in Painswick, though, it is completely understandable – it is a small, peaceful and intimate Cotswold village, and the Retreat is clearly intended to fit respectfully into that setting. It certainly didn’t stop us enjoying ourselves it simply means guests need to be considerate of the surroundings, particularly at night. Thank you Tim and Sue for a wonderful weekend."

ARC Painswick
8/10 Good
"We liked the swimming pool, the large kitchen island worked for us and the numerous living rooms. Good sized bedrooms and all have zip links therefore singles if required and have access to private bathrooms. We really enjoyed the house and would like to return. A recycling bin in the kitchen would be useful. Bedrooms could do with more storage i.e. chest of drawers and more hanging space. A towel rail would have been useful. Should be made aware that the village parking is for 23 hours and your car has to be moved out of the car park for at least an hour. Dropping off at the property and picking up is difficult because of the narrowness of the roads. could make people aware of this. More padded cushions and cushions required for the stone seats outside. Also the wooden furniture needs repainting and there is a broken chair. One of the single chairs in the living room the straps underneath were broken. No storage for own food other than fridges. Another fridge in the bar area would have been useful. The entrance door was a problem we couldn't lock it and then we couldn't unlock it, the instructions were not clear how to wake up the key pad. The dining room door with a lock on was not working. It should be made clearer regarding noise restrictions prior to booking."
